Leica Summicron-TL 23mm f/2 11081

£850.00*

incl. VAT

* This item is sold with margin scheme taxation. Included VAT will not be stated on the invoice.

Available, delivery time 2-5 days

Product number: 11081SH-4269075
Product information
Top condition with clean, scratch free optics. Full function with front and rear caps only
Technical Data
Serial Number 4269075
Condition A-
Guarantee 12 months
Manufacture Year 2014
Sold by
Leica Store London Mayfair

64 - 66 Duke St
W1K 6JD London
UK
+44 20 7629 1351
london.mayfair@leica-camera.com

Monday - Tuesday: 10am - 6pm
Wednesday: 10am - 7pm
Thursday - Saturday: 10am - 6pm
Sunday: 12am - 6pm

Shipping and Payment Information
Terms of Service
Privacy